The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) reported that the 2020 median pay for dietitians and nutritionists was $63,090 open_in_new per year. There is a considerable difference, however, between the median annual pay of the lowest 10% of earners and the highest 10%: $39,840 and over $90,000 in 2020, respectively.

This certificate allows you to earn a Didactic Program in Dietetics (DPD) Verification Statement without enrolling in a full degree program. Possession of a DPD Verification Statement establishes your eligibility to sit for the Nutrition and Dietetic Technician, Registered (NDTR) examination to earn the NDTR credential. If you’re interested in becoming a registered dietitian, these are five steps you’ll need to complete: Step 1: Earn an accredited bachelor’s or master’s degree. Step 2: Complete a dietetic internship. Step 3: Pass the Commission on Dietetic Registration (CDR) exam. Step 4: Obtain a state license. A didactic program in dietetics (DPD) is a program that culminates in a bachelor’s or graduate degree and includes all required coursework. Some specialty certifications in dietetics and/or nutrition help to satisfy the CDR’s CPE requirements for a five-year renewal period. Often, recertification in the same specialty can satisfy consecutive renewal period CPE requirements.
